MAS Implements Calibrated Tightening of Singapore Dollar Policy Amid Energy Price Risks

The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S) enacted a calibrated tightening of its monetary policy in the July 2026 Monetary Policy Statement (MPS), according to UOB strategists. This move involved a modest increase in the Singapore Dollar (SGD) Nominal Effective Exchange Rate (NEER) slope to an estimated 1.25% per annum, which is smaller than the tightening implemented in April 2026. The width and centre of the S$NEER band were left unchanged, indicating a more measured approach to policy adjustment [1].

UOB interprets the July 2026 tightening as a 25 basis point slope steepening to 1.25% per annum, reflecting MAS's cautious stance in response to current economic conditions. The strategists expect MAS to maintain this policy setting for the remainder of 2026 and into 2027. However, they highlight the risk of a further 25 basis point increase in the slope, potentially raising it to 1.50% per annum in the October 2026 or January 2027 MPS, if energy prices remain high and begin to impact the broader Consumer Price Index (CPI) basket [1].

Additionally, UOB notes that they will monitor for signs of demand-pull pressures, particularly if there is a significantly larger-than-expected positive output gap. Such developments could prompt MAS to consider further tightening measures to address inflationary risks [1].

CONCLUSION

MAS's latest policy adjustment signals a cautious approach to tightening, with the potential for further action if energy prices and demand pressures persist. UOB expects the current settings to remain, but flags upside risks to the policy stance.
